Understanding the MAX56X Family of Chips
The MAX56X integrated circuit family represents a powerful collection of audio drivers from Maxim Corp, engineered for a broad variety of uses. These compact ICs are particularly known for their outstanding performance and minimal energy usage. Key attributes include adjustable gain, onboard protection against short circuits, and a adjustable power supply. They are commonly employed in portable players, such as earphones, mobile phones, and multiple gadgets.
